Specifications
Lattice Semiconductor Corporation LFE2M35SE-5FN484I technical specifications, attributes, parameters and parts with similar specifications to Lattice Semiconductor Corporation LFE2M35SE-5FN484I.
  • Factory Lead Time
    8 Weeks
  • Mount
    Surface Mount
  • Mounting Type
    Surface Mount
  • Package / Case
    484-BBGA
  • Number of Pins
    484
  • Operating Temperature
    -40°C~100°C TJ
  • Packaging
    Tray
  • Published
    2008
  • Series
    ECP2M
  • JESD-609 Code
    e1
  • Pbfree Code
    yes
  • Part Status
    Active
  • Moisture Sensitivity Level (MSL)
    3 (168 Hours)
  • Number of Terminations
    484
  • ECCN Code
    EAR99
  • Terminal Finish
    Tin/Silver/Copper (Sn/Ag/Cu)
  • HTS Code
    8542.39.00.01
  • Subcategory
    Field Programmable Gate Arrays
  • Voltage - Supply
    1.14V~1.26V
  • Terminal Position
    BOTTOM
  • Terminal Form
    BALL
  • Peak Reflow Temperature (Cel)
    250
  • Supply Voltage
    1.2V
  • Terminal Pitch
    1mm
  • Reflow Temperature-Max (s)
    30
  • Base Part Number
    LFE2M35
  • Pin Count
    484
  • Number of Outputs
    303
  • Qualification Status
    Not Qualified
  • Operating Supply Voltage
    1.2V
  • Memory Size
    271.5kB
  • Number of I/O
    303
  • RAM Size
    262.6kB
  • Programmable Logic Type
    FIELD PROGRAMMABLE GATE ARRAY
  • Number of Logic Elements/Cells
    34000
  • Total RAM Bits
    2151424
  • Max Frequency
    320MHz
  • Number of LABs/CLBs
    4250
  • Combinatorial Delay of a CLB-Max
    0.358 ns
  • Height Seated (Max)
    2.6mm
  • Length
    23mm
  • Width
    23mm
  • RoHS Status
    ROHS3 Compliant
  • Lead Free
    Lead Free

LFE2M35SE-5FN484I Overview
This product features 484 pins and a terminal finish of Tin/Silver/Copper (Sn/Ag/Cu). Its HTS code is 8542.39.00.01 and the terminal position is BOTTOM. With a supply voltage of 1.2V, it offers a memory size of 271.5kB and a high number of logic elements/cells at 34000. The maximum seated height is 2.6mm and the width is 23mm.
